A landlord tenant lawyer is a legal professional who specializes in resolving disputes between landlords and tenants. These lawyers are well-versed in landlord-tenant laws and regulations, and they play a crucial role in ensuring that both parties adhere to their legal obligations.
Landlord-tenant disputes can arise for a variety of reasons, ranging from lease violations and eviction proceedings to security deposit disputes and maintenance issues. When these conflicts occur, seeking the assistance of a landlord tenant lawyer can help both parties navigate the legal system and reach a fair resolution.
One of the primary responsibilities of a landlord tenant lawyer is to provide legal advice and representation to their clients. For landlords, this may involve drafting lease agreements, handling eviction proceedings, and addressing tenant complaints. For tenants, a lawyer can help enforce their rights, negotiate with their landlord, and defend against eviction.
In cases where disputes cannot be resolved through negotiation or mediation, a landlord tenant lawyer can represent their client in court. This includes filing lawsuits, presenting evidence, and arguing on behalf of their client in front of a judge. These legal proceedings can be complex and time-consuming, so having a skilled lawyer on your side can make a significant difference in the outcome of the case.
In addition to representing their clients in court, landlord tenant lawyers also work to prevent legal issues from arising in the first place. By reviewing lease agreements, ensuring compliance with state and local laws, and providing guidance on landlord-tenant relationships, these lawyers can help their clients avoid costly disputes and litigation.
